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: 1.Patients met the diagnostic criteria for SUI. 2.Aged 18-75 years oldfemale. 3.Sandvik Urinary incontinence index =3. 4.Routine urinalysis shows no abnormalities. 5.The patient had never received electroacupuncture treatment within or before the 3 months prior to enrollment. 6.No mental or intellectual abnormality able to understand the terms of each scale and complete the assessment. 7.Agree to participate in this study and sign written informed consent.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: 1.Other types of urinary incontinence: such as mixed urinary incontinence urge urinary incontinence and over-distended urinary incontinence; patients with severe heart liver kidney and other major diseases; or patients with severe liver and kidney function impairment; 2.Patients with pelvic organ prolapse of = Grade II history of urinary incontinence surgery or pelvic floor surgery; 3.History of recurrent urinary tract infections (=3 times/year); 4.Residual urine =100ml (bladder ultrasound); 5.Pregnant or breastfeeding women patients with malignant tumors and urinary system diseases (such as urinary stones urinary tuberculosis); 6.Patients who have received medication pelvic floor muscle exercises transdermal electrical stimulation or other treatments for this condition within the last month; 7.Patients with cardiac pacemakers blood diseases diabetes mental disorders spinal cord lesions or intervertebral disc diseases; 8.Patients with ulcers abscesses skin infections or other conditions at the acupuncture site; patients with metal allergies or severe needle phobia; 9.Those who have participated in other clinical medical trials within the last month; 10.Patients with metal allergies or severe needle phobia; 11.Patients with cough or other conditions that can increase abdominal pressure within the last week.
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| the change in 1-hour pad test urine leakage volume at the 8th week; |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| 1-hour pad test urine leakage volume;72-hour incontinence episodes;Average Weekly Pad Usage;Correlation of Urinary Incontinence Severity;ICIQ-SF;Subjective Efficacy Evaluation by Patients;72-hour voiding diary; | — |
